Charter.
A written grant of authority from the king is typically known as a royal charter. It is a formal document issued by a monarch that grants specific rights, powers, privileges, or titles to individuals, organizations, or towns. Royal charters were commonly used in medieval and early modern Europe to establish colonies, towns, universities, and trade organizations.

The Persian Empire under Darius and Cyrus followed a system of absolute monarchy with the king, known as the Great King, having supreme authority. The empire was divided into provinces called satrapies, each governed by a satrap who collected taxes and enforced the king's laws. The king also had a council of advisors known as the royal council to assist in decision-making.

A grant of probate is a legal document issued by a court that confirms the validity of a deceased person's will and gives authority to the named executor to administer the estate according to the terms of the will. It allows the executor to collect and distribute the assets of the deceased individual in accordance with the law.
